    • PROBLEM TO BE SOLVED: To provide rolling control and continue operation even when an angular velocity sensor causes a failure in a rolling controller of a farm working machine equipped with a tilt sensor for detecting tilt angles of left and right tilts of a traveling machine body, an angular velocity sensor for detecting angular velocities in the left and right tilt directions of the traveling machine body and a rolling controlling means for subjecting a ground implement to driving and rolling so as to maintain the ground tilt posture in the left and right directions of the ground implement at the set angle based on values detected with both the sensors in the traveling machine body connecting the ground implement thereto so as to freely perform driving and rolling.
      SOLUTION: The rolling controller of the farm working machine is equipped with a failure detecting means judging whether or not the angular velocity sensor causes the failure. The rolling controller is composed as follows. When the angular velocity sensor in the failure is detected, the rolling control based on the values detected with only the angular velocity sensor is performed.

    • PROBLEM TO BE SOLVED: To simplify a constitution and reduce cost of an operation restraining circuit, to easily perform an operation of operation restraining equipment even during maintenance with a controller removed, and to use detection by each switch of the operation restraining circuit for a controlling operation of the controller.
      SOLUTION: A plurality of switches S for restraining operation are connected to the operation restraining equipment 2 in series, and a predetermined switch S is connected to the controller 8 via switching circuit 7 employing a transistor connected to the switch S in parallel.

    • PROBLEM TO BE SOLVED: To comfortably operate a hydraulic actuator (attachment).
      SOLUTION: This hydraulic system for a working machine includes the hydraulic actuator A for performing operation, a control valve 27 supplying a hydraulic fluid to the actuator according to pilot pressure, a proportional solenoid valve 28 controlling the pilot pressure of the control valve 27, and a control section 31 controlling the proportional solenoid valve 28. The control section 31 is provided with a current control means 33 controlling a current of the proportional solenoid valve 28 by a pulse control signal S3 generated by voltage modulation. The current control means 33 is configured to control the current dither amplitude IA of the proportional solenoid valve 28 by maintaining a cycle and a duty ratio of the pulse control signal S3 constant and changing the amplitude VA of the pulse control signal S3.
